Heat pump repair services focus on diagnosing and fixing issues that affect the performance of heat pumps, which are systems used for heating and cooling residential and commercial properties. These services typically involve inspecting components such as the compressor, fan motors, refrigerant levels, and electrical connections to identify malfunctions. Technicians may repair or replace faulty parts, recharge refrigerant, or address electrical problems to restore the system’s efficiency and proper operation. Regular repairs help ensure that heat pumps continue to provide reliable climate control throughout the year.

Many common problems that heat pump repair services address include reduced heating or cooling capacity, strange noises, short cycling, or system failure to turn on. These issues can be caused by refrigerant leaks, worn-out components, dirty filters, or electrical faults. Prompt repairs can prevent further damage, improve energy efficiency, and extend the lifespan of the heat pump. Service providers often perform thorough diagnostics to pinpoint the root cause of the problem and recommend the appropriate repairs to restore optimal functioning.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for heat pump repairs ranges from $200 to $1,200, depending on the issue. Minor component replacements may be closer to the lower end, while major repairs can approach the higher end of the spectrum.

Labor Expenses - Labor charges for heat pump repairs usually fall between $75 and $150 per hour. Total costs depend on the complexity of the repair and the local service provider’s rates.

Parts Replacement - Replacing parts such as thermostats or capacitors generally costs between $50 and $300. More extensive component replacements, like compressors, tend to be on the higher side.

Additional Fees - Service fees or diagnostic charges may add $50 to $150 to the overall cost. These fees vary based on the service provider and the scope of the initial assessment.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
